[sdiy] 8bits, 10bits or12bits DAC for a midi2cv converter?
Tom Wiltshire
tom at electricdruid.net
Fri Oct 19 13:16:02 CEST 2007
On 18 Oct 2007, at 20:30, m.bareille at free.fr wrote:
>
> Exact !
>
> On the other side this quantized effect can be musicaly very
> interesting...
>
> If the DAC have a 10/12/16 bits resolution and be driven by a
> classic 7bits CC
> value ( 128steps ) , this suppose the CPU to compute an
> interpolation to get all
> in between steps values according to the DAC resolution , to avoid
> the steppy
> effect. No a simple thing to implement, i think , specialy on small
> PIC chips...
It does make the chip work quite hard, but you can do linear
interpolation on even a 16F series PIC. My envelope generator
firmware uses it to fill in between datapoints for the exponential
envelope curves. It works very well at making the output smooth, even
with a 10-bit PWM output.
T.
More information about the Synth-diy
mailing list